Brain-Based Psychological Health Treatment for Addiction Healing

New approaches to addiction healing are increasingly incorporating the principles of neuroscience – a field now known as neuro-focused mental health intervention. This evolving approach get more info moves beyond traditional psychological interventions, recognizing that substance abuse fundamentally alters neurological structure. Techniques might include neurofeedback to help individuals regulate neurological processes, or cognitive training exercises designed to strengthen executive abilities impaired by drug abuse. Ultimately, neurological therapy aims to restore neurological health, thereby decreasing compulsions and promoting long-term abstinence.
